Key facts from 30 Remsen Avenue Condominium's documents

Reflects the 2009 governing documents — figures and rules are as originally recorded and may have changed since.

Community type
Condominium (Title: '30 Remsen Avenue Condominium')
Legal name
30 Remsen Avenue Condominium
Developer / declarant
Samuel Schwimmer and Barbara Schwimmer and Moshe Eichler and Brany Eichler and Joel Stern and Razy Stern
Governing law
Article 9-B of the Real Property Law of the State of New York (Title and Article 2)
Assessments & dues
Condominium Board prepares and adopts a budget and levies Common Charges and Special Assessments pro rata according to Common Interests. (By-Laws Sections 2.2(A)(iv) and 6.1)
Special assessments
Charges allocated and assessed by the Condominium Board pro rata in accordance with Common Interests, except as otherwise provided. (Exhibit C definition (33); By-Laws Secti)
Collections & liens
Condominium Board may enforce payment of Common Charges; default procedures are set forth in Article 6 of By-Laws (text not fully provided). (By-Laws Article 6, particularly Section )
Leasing & rentals
Leasing is permitted. Unsold Units may be leased to any person. For other Units, a Right of First Refusal procedure exists in Article 7 of By-Laws. (By-Laws Article 7; Declaration Article 8)
Architectural approval
Prior written approval of Condominium Board required for any structural alteration, addition, improvement, or repair to a Unit or its appurtenant Limited Common Elements, with exceptions for Sponsor's Unsold Units. (By-Laws Section 5.3(A) and (B))
Home business
A Unit may be used as a business office if such use complies with law and does not violate existing zoning. (Declaration Article 8(a): 'may also be u)
Maintenance
Not explicitly stated, but roof appears to be part of General Common Elements as it is part of Building structure. (By-Laws Section 5.1(A)(ii) - General Com)
Insurance
Fire insurance with extended coverage, vandalism and malicious mischief endorsements, insuring the Building including all Units and bathroom/kitchen fixtures but not appliances or personal property. Also general liability insurance with sin (By-Laws Section 5.4(A) and (C)(ii))
Use restrictions
Each Unit may be used only as a residence, except retail and community facility units may be used for commercial/professional purposes. Also, Sponsor may use Unsold Units for selling, renting, management, etc. (Declaration Article 8(a))
Voting & meetings
One vote per Unit owned by the Unit Owner (By-Laws Section 4.7(A): 'Unit Owner shal)
Amendments
Declaration may be amended by vote or written consent of Unit Owners owning at least 66-2/3% of Common Interests (except as otherwise provided). Sponsor may amend without other consent under certain conditions. No amendment that affects Spo (Declaration Article 17; By-Laws Article )
